#e9da78 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e9da78 is composed of 91.4% red, 85.5%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 6.4% magenta, 48.5% yellow and 8.6% black. It has a hue angle of 52 degrees, a saturation of 72% and a lightness of 69.2%. #e9da78 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ffff0 with #d3b500.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c66.

Shades and Tints of #e9da78

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110f03 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e9da78

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b3b2ae is the less saturated color, while #fbe766 is the most saturated one.
